From patchwork Wed Jul 21 23:26:16 2021 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Dmitry Osipenko X-Patchwork-Id: 12392511 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-14.8 required=3.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,FREEMAIL_FORGED_FROMDOMAIN,FREEMAIL_FROM, HEADER_FROM_DIFFERENT_DOMAINS,INCLUDES_CR_TRAILER,INCLUDES_PATCH, SPF_HELO_NONE,SPF_PASS,USER_AGENT_GIT autolearn=ham aut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 4CC06C6377A for ; Wed, 21 Jul 2021 23:26:50 +0000 (UTC) Received: by mail.kernel.org (Postfix) id 08D686121E; Wed, 21 Jul 2021 23:26:50 +0000 (UTC) Received: from mail-lj1-f172.google.com (mail-lj1-f172.google.com [209.85.208.172]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id CCEAD6120C; Wed, 21 Jul 2021 23:26:49 +0000 (UTC) D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org CCEAD6120C Authentication-Results: mail.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com Authentication-Results: mail.kernel.org; spf=pass smtp.mailfrom=digetx@gmail.com Received: by mail-lj1-f172.google.com with SMTP id e14so5080093ljo.7; Wed, 21 Jul 2021 16:26:49 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=from:to:cc:subject:date:message-id:mime-version :content-transfer-encoding; bh=Il8UJhGjpnmDj53189lXqkD37q5sKtSo66wNqc5Vg6s=; b=FETA6EXuOLfRCzWuWoDNBcuxD19MHcO7al3jDz2bgwQbnkgcyBmyBV5UmVtUVMvjv4 YFz17ZeOTPHL9VSVRwQxIGWsss030dCcd+mlkzJQmbRFmqB1kLLWmwwey09xzVVyXTtp psZsVLgdvoNLTrRmySx6j28CgbK8i1V8xRx1V4AoJr3hNdJemw1Qv0HbfEiJS7h8h9Be MksqFXVecOch1uCbtNHPbqN1El74Qxd1gVenS585EP+J4qggxDAGfgsXKIZSSnDL45/y Z/rUngHbohqmg2RtFcPhtXQvhCDNlr4ouJ9P0cthSqNdbFittrp30JPW5Vtsq1eB+4Ou q+4g==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:mime-version :content-transfer-encoding; bh=Il8UJhGjpnmDj53189lXqkD37q5sKtSo66wNqc5Vg6s=; b=uH0AYMVxOlc/Fwyw0L61Qw38eR8pEoFzIPdgCn9j6NKrvV8R2DkcREB1pbkgcl992P W5xB61BRedhp1/8bmlyBhuARs4ckLpYVX9CNkmH/zZhOVRufWLmzu+/RcAk0uB0BkuO6 INXmB5U0pqLX5yomaKsq/uRTHMvj4gHd3urp7eIrP70q25at0qPmJQi3bjPXjjmXJG0E KVsjpB9MHNU1U7RhzxxnXu/Z+gjf7uNbchXRL1X1vsCT4E3dDlhBjFYNMcZffg8DhS9l TtCXHz06aaOKlS8KVVB4xmg4ClNR9dytDWhs8mbdTBdQojzyrSAp+tZV9QR9WH0VzeZW cxEA== X-Gm-Message-State: AOAM531bazbLio9iQAeiFmBWlFmhIMkKDdeKRFLficok1VLTorWvpnK2 ytj5shFCiZxdOTPHRRActIU= X-Google-Smtp-Source: ABdhPJwuJINA3x8dOeYPlYtlUIejwdIani8/VDGazBclVy2E9Kr3PNSAFVIBVHnB2LJlhwalaUG+yA== X-Received: by 2002:a2e:9695:: with SMTP id q21mr5223735lji.509.1626910008292; Wed, 21 Jul 2021 16:26:48 -0700 (PDT) Received: from localhost.localdomain (79-139-184-182.dynamic.spd-mgts.ru. [79.139.184.182]) by smtp.gmail.com with ESMTPSA id u10sm2940026ljl.122.2021.07.21.16.26.47 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 21 Jul 2021 16:26:47 -0700 (PDT) From: Dmitry Osipenko To: Thierry Reding , Jonathan Hunter , Arnd Bergmann List-Id: Cc: Mark Brown , soc@kernel.org, linux-kernel@vger.kernel.org, linux-tegra@vger.kernel.org Subject: [PATCH v2] soc/tegra: Make regulator couplers depend on CONFIG_REGULATOR Date: Thu, 22 Jul 2021 02:26:16 +0300 Message-Id: <20210721232616.1935-1-digetx@gmail.com> X-Mailer: git-send-email 2.32.0 MIME-Version: 1.0 The regulator coupler drivers now use regulator-driver API function that isn't available during compile-testing. Make regulator coupler drivers dependent on CONFIG_REGULATOR in Kconfig. Fixes: 03978d42ed0d ("soc/tegra: regulators: Bump voltages on system reboot") Reported-by: kernel test robot Signed-off-by: Dmitry Osipenko Acked-by: Jon Hunter --- Changelog: v2: - No changes. Re-sending to Arnd Bergmann and soc@kernel.org. drivers/soc/tegra/Kconfig |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/drivers/soc/tegra/Kconfig b/drivers/soc/tegra/Kconfig index db49075b1946..1224e1c8c2c9 100644 --- a/drivers/soc/tegra/Kconfig +++ b/drivers/soc/tegra/Kconfig @@ -15,7 +15,7 @@ config ARCH_TEGRA_2x_SOC select PL310_ERRATA_769419 if CACHE_L2X0 select SOC_TEGRA_FLOWCTRL select SOC_TEGRA_PMC - select SOC_TEGRA20_VOLTAGE_COUPLER + select SOC_TEGRA20_VOLTAGE_COUPLER if REGULATOR select TEGRA_TIMER help Support for NVIDIA Tegra AP20 and T20 processors, based on the @@ -29,7 +29,7 @@ config ARCH_TEGRA_3x_SOC select PL310_ERRATA_769419 if CACHE_L2X0 select SOC_TEGRA_FLOWCTRL select SOC_TEGRA_PMC - select SOC_TEGRA30_VOLTAGE_COUPLER + select SOC_TEGRA30_VOLTAGE_COUPLER if REGULATOR select TEGRA_TIMER help Support for NVIDIA Tegra T30 processor family, based on the @@ -154,7 +154,9 @@ config SOC_TEGRA_POWERGATE_BPMP config SOC_TEGRA20_VOLTAGE_COUPLER bool "Voltage scaling support for Tegra20 SoCs" depends on ARCH_TEGRA_2x_SOC || COMPILE_TEST + depends on REGULATOR config SOC_TEGRA30_VOLTAGE_COUPLER bool "Voltage scaling support for Tegra30 SoCs" depends on ARCH_TEGRA_3x_SOC || COMPILE_TEST + depends on REGULATOR